What will you be doing?
As a Senior Associate - Digital Transformation: GenAI Implementation Consultant, you will collaborate within multidisciplinary teams, including software developers, data analysts, ERP specialists, and business experts. Your contribution is key in transforming our client experience through advanced AI strategies. Your role is adaptable to specific project needs, ranging from strategic reorientation to process optimization and technology implementation.
Your work environment is dynamic; it ranges from working at a client's offices or at the PwC office to the flexibility of working from home. To meet the needs of our customers, we continuously invest globally in the development of our team members, our skills, and the innovative tools that we use to help our clients transform sustainably and stay ahead of the competition. This leads to many opportunities to develop yourself into a "trusted boardroom advisor".
As a Senior Associate the activities that you will be working on include:
- Integrating with teams to implement GenAI solutions and complex prompts for internal and client?'facing engagements.
- Guiding deployment processes for AI software development with our internal teams.
- Applying agile methodologies, working with tools like Azure DevOps or Jira.
- Identifying and creating strategic GenAI solutions via advanced prompt engineering on our proprietary platform to optimize client offerings and internal processes.
- Bridging communication between software and business teams to tailor AI solutions.
- Learning necessary business, accounting, and finance concepts relevant to each project.
- Ensuring timely completion of onboarding and training for both technical and non?'technical skills.
Does this describe you?
You have a combination of strategic and analytical insights and are passionate about emerging technologies. Your enthusiasm for Artificial Intelligence and proficiency in programming make you an asset to our team. You are also ambitious, want to solve complex problems and make an impact on our customers. You are people?'oriented and enjoy working together in multidisciplinary teams. In addition, you can create powerful reports and visuals and give convincing presentations for (senior) management.
- You have at least a year of experience in GenAI concepts such as RAG, agents, and AI model integrations.
- You have a bachelor's or master's deg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, Information Technology, Information Management, or Data Science.
- You have affinity for Artificial Intelligence and data programming.
- You are interested in finance, business, accounting, and audit sectors.
- You are proficient in programming languages, enabling vibe?'coding and open?'source software integration.
- You have experience with version control systems like Git and agile methodologies such as Azure DevOps or Jira.
- You are fluent in English; Dutch skills are an advantage.
